Only two individuals pointed out that this would not be possible (in consecutive frames) due to the speed of travel of a bullet versus film frame speeds of the Zapruder film. While this is technically correct, it is also a bit misleading. One individual suggested that the bullet speed was around 1700 FPS (Feet per Second). This is actually incorrect; the bullet speed of a 6.5 round from the Mannlicher-Carcano is over 2,000 FPS, so is actually even faster than 1700 FPS. So, it is true, a bullet could not be captured in consecutive frames, but does not mean a bullet could not be captured in any individual frames. If a bullet was indeed captured in any of the frames between Z-310 to Z-317, the most likely frame is Z-314. We may never know the answer until our technology advances.

The types of elevators used in the Texas School Book Depository in 1963 were the old type where the gates (doors) have to be manually closed. These types of elevators were supplied with some built in safety features. One of those features is that the elevator will not move with the gates even partially open. The other feature is that the gates were designed so that a person could not stick their arms through the gates once closed. In an article posted a couple of weeks back by Rob Clark, I noticed part of the article where DPD police said they couldn’t call the elevators because the gates were stuck closed. That statement is incorrect. If the gates were closed, the elevators would be able to be called to other floors. It is only when the gates are open, that no one can call the elevator to a different floor. This is very important.
